我找到了这个

How to enable the (two finger) zoom in/out feature for an image in android

在日志中,我看到它正在运行,但是图像没有改变,我在做什么错?

这是我的XML

private static final String TAG = "Touch";

//These matrices will be used to move and zoom image

Matrix matrix = new Matrix();

Matrix savedMatrix = new Matrix();

// We can be in one of these 3 states

static final int NONE = 0;

static final int DRAG = 1;

static final int ZOOM = 2;

static final int DRAW =3;

int mode = NONE;

// Remember some things for zooming

PointF start = new PointF();

PointF mid = new PointF();

float oldDist = 1f;

// Limit zoomable/pannable image

private float[] matrixValues = new float[9];

private float maxZoom;

private float minZoom;

private float height;

private float width;

private RectF viewRect;

/************ touch events functions **************

@Override

public void onWindowFocusChanged(boolean hasFocus) {

super.onWindowFocusChanged(hasFocus);

if(hasFocus){ init(); }

}

private void init() {

maxZoom = 4;

minZoom = 0.25f;

height = myimage.getDrawable().getIntrinsicHeight()+20;

width = myimage.getDrawable().getIntrinsicWidth()+20;

viewRect = new RectF(0, 0, myimage.getWidth()+20, myimage.getHeight()+20);

}

/************touch events for image Moving, panning and zooming ***********///

public boolean onTouch(View v, MotionEvent event) {

// Dump touch event to log

dumpEvent(event);

// Handle touch events here...

switch (event.getAction() & MotionEvent.ACTION_MASK) {

case MotionEvent.ACTION_DOWN:

savedMatrix.set(matrix);

start.set(event.getX(), event.getY());

Log.d(TAG, "mode=DRAG");

mode = DRAG;

break;

case MotionEvent.ACTION_POINTER_DOWN:

oldDist = spacing(event);

Log.d(TAG, "oldDist=" + oldDist);

if (oldDist > 10f) {

savedMatrix.set(matrix);

midPoint(mid, event);

mode = ZOOM;

Log.d(TAG, "mode=ZOOM");

}

break;

case MotionEvent.ACTION_UP:

case MotionEvent.ACTION_POINTER_UP:

mode = NONE;

Log.d(TAG, "mode=NONE");

break;

case MotionEvent.ACTION_MOVE:

if (mode == DRAW){ onTouchEvent(event);}

if (mode == DRAG) {

///code for draging..

}

else if (mode == ZOOM) {

float newDist = spacing(event);

Log.d(TAG, "newDist=" + newDist);

if (newDist > 10f) {

matrix.set(savedMatrix);

float scale = newDist / oldDist;

matrix.getValues(matrixValues);

float currentScale = matrixValues[Matrix.MSCALE_X];

// limit zoom

if (scale * currentScale > maxZoom) {

scale = maxZoom / currentScale;

}else if(scale * currentScale < minZoom){

scale = minZoom / currentScale;

}

matrix.postScale(scale, scale, mid.x, mid.y);

}

}

break;

}

myimage.setImageMatrix(matrix);

return true; // indicate event was handled

}

//*******************Determine the space between the first two fingers

private float spacing(MotionEvent event) {

float x = event.getX(0) - event.getX(1);

float y = event.getY(0) - event.getY(1);

return FloatMath.sqrt(x * x + y * y);

}

//************* Calculate the mid point of the first two fingers

private void midPoint(PointF point, MotionEvent event) {

float x = event.getX(0) + event.getX(1);

float y = event.getY(0) + event.getY(1);

point.set(x / 2, y / 2);

}
